Volvo and Boliden Achieve Milestone in Autonomous Transport at Swedish Mine
Volvo Autonomous Solutions and mining company Boliden have successfully completed an autonomous transport project at the Garpenberg site in Sweden. The project involved moving nearly 700,000 tonnes of rock fill material without drivers, using Volvo's autonomous haulage system. This system completed over 11,000 transport cycles, covering 56,000 kilometers. The material was used to reinforce a local dam, marking a significant achievement in autonomous transport technology. The project is part of a memorandum of understanding signed in 2023 between Volvo and Boliden, aiming to explore further collaboration in autonomous solutions.
